Palamedes' Shield Tombs, Explained
As you explore Cuanacht, you can come across two different tombs – the Tomb of Sir Gawain and the Tomb of Sir Dagonet.
Unlike normal caves, crypts, and other locations, these tombs are for former members of the Knights Of The Round Table and other important figures in Arthur's circle.
Because of this, they can only be opened if you've obtained the fragment of Arthur's Soul from Palamedes' Shield during the main story, similar to the tombs in the Forlorn Swords and the one in the Horns Of The South.

Once this portion of the main story is done, and you've obtained Palamedes' Shield, you'll now be able to go around to these different tombs and open them up by interacting with the altar with the shield insignia on it by the doorway.
The Tomb Of Sir Gawain
The Tomb of Sir Gawain is located west of Cuanacht, the city, and can be found on a cliff above the river. The easiest way to reach it is to start at the Wyrdtower fast travel point, then go south down the road until you find a path curving down to the cliffside, cross the small bridge, then follow the path down to the tomb.
If you've met Ó Cuinn Cinnamonsage on the island behind the beach where you first woke up after the 168澳洲幸运5开奖网:Island Asylum, you'll find him next to this bridge now, 🧔and he'll in🐼vite you to share his nearby home, the Cozy Cave, if you need it.
Interact with the altar outside, and when you enter, you will automatically start the side quest His Heart Was Greener Than Mine. Begin following the path, and you'll encounter some enemies to fight as you make your way down: Curlghasts, and🏅 a few Dryads.
When you reach the large chamber at the bottom, there'll be some Marrowghasts to fight, both blind and non-blind variants, and you can find three chests. There's one behind the tree, one on the hill above you need to dig up, and another to dig up beneath the staircase.
Jump across the broken bridge and speak to Sir Bertilak in the circular room at the end of the hall. As part of the side quest, you'll need to challenge Sir Bertilak to a duel.
First, you'll fight Sir Bertilak, and he 168澳洲幸运5开奖网:fights similarly to Galahad, with powerful two-handed strikes, a ranged magic attack from his axe, a trio of fireballs as another ranged attack, and a magic shield that blocks and repels damage.
Once he's defeated, Sir Gawain will awaken, and you'll have to fight him next. He has a similar moveset to Sir Bertilak, but much stronger, and his regular attacks inflict poison, which can quickly chew threw your health if you don't offset it by consuming food or with a potion.
- Sir Bertilak's body can be looted to obtain the Green Knight Axe and the Green Knight armor set, consisting of his Gauntlets, Chestpiece, Sabatons, Helm, Greaves, and Cloak.
- Sir Gawain's body can be looted to obtain the Oath of Famine greatsword, and Sir Gawain's Weathered armor set, consisting of his Gauntlets, Cuirass, Sabons, and Helm.
After they're dead and put to rest, you can take the stairs behind Gawain's throne to his actual crypt, and next to it is a curving path that will take you back to the entrance.
You can have a conversation with King Arthur about Gawain at your 168澳洲幸运5开奖网:next fueled Bonfire after completing the tomb and His Heart Was Greener Than Mine.
Upon leaving, you'll be visited by Fionola, a member of the Royal Geographers' Guild, and you can choose to join them, though this doesn't start a side quest with her.
The Tomb Of Sir Dagonet
The Tomb of Sir Dagonet is located on the northern side of Cuanacht, and to find it, you'll want to start at either the Kamelot Gate fast travel point or, if you haven't found that yet, the Plains fast travel point.
From either of them, head southeast towards the large mountain formation that cuts through the region, following the main path going to the east through the gate and past the ruins filled with Wyrdspawn.
Once you start getting close to the Forlorn Swords Northern Gate, break away from the main path and veer off to the south, and follow the partially hidden stairs up to the tomb in the cliff wall.
Inside, you won't automatically start a quest this time, but there's still more to do. Dagonet's tomb is filled with all sorts of traps, and the first one is a fast-firing arrow trap on the wall. Run or slide past it, and you'll get to a long hallway.
The first section doesn't have any traps, but the next part has two sections of wall arrow traps, and, like before, you'll need to run or slide past them or risk dying from the arrows' high damage.
When you turn the corner at the end of the hallway, there's going to be a flamethrower trap coming from a gargoyle statue, and all yᩚᩚᩚᩚᩚᩚᩚᩚᩚ𒀱ᩚᩚᩚou need to do is wait for the pause in the fl𒁃ames before running around either side of it.
If you take the path to the right past the gargoyle, there's a hidden doorway in the wall that leads to a crypt area with an Undead and a wall tunnel back to the gargoyle room.
Take the doorway to the left to continue, and one of the paintings in the hall will fly off the wall and try to damage you. At the bottom of the stairs, you'll come to a branching pathway, with a center alcove with a casket you ♐can loot.
Both paths lead to the same location, but have different traps to deal with. The left path features more wall arrow traps, while the right path introduces ghostly hands that reach out from the paintings on the walls.
In the next room, there's a hidden doorway in the wall that leads to a fatal drop, and the path forward is down the stairs and past an Undead enemy.
The next trap is a large swinging cleaver, and you can run past it when it reaches either end of its path. Another painting and some ghost hands will try to hurt you near the crypts with caskets on them, then go up the stairs, into the hole in the wall, and jump down the hole to the next floor.
There are more swinging cleavers in the next hallway, and they move faster than before. Run past the first two cleavers, keep close to the wider flooring on the right side of the hall to avoid the pit, then jump across to the bit of floor before the third cleaver, then run past it.
In the next room, there's another hidden door on the right with a casket inside, then another painting to dodge, and at the bottom of the room, you'll have to go through a hidden door on the left to keep progressing.
Defeat the Lost Knight, then go up the stairs and down into the main crypt. You can loot the Last Jet set from a sack inside the crypt, which has Gloves, Doublet, Slippers, Cowl, and Breeches. Take the portal door at the end of the hall, and you'll be returned to the entrance.
Outside, you'll have another conversation with Fionola, from whom you can get more information about Sir Dagonet, and she'll suggest you continue searching for the other tombs.
